Sea Island Red Peas have a flavor profile that’s rich, earthy, and deeply savory, with a subtle nutty sweetness. When cooked, their texture is tender but slightly firm, offering a pleasant bite that holds up well in stews, soups, and rice dishes. The flavor is often described as robust and hearty, carrying hints of smokiness and a mild, natural sweetness that complements spices without being overpowering. Compared to standard red beans, Sea Island Red Peas have a more pronounced, almost buttery depth, with an earthy undertone that evokes traditional Southern and Caribbean cooking.
They pair beautifully with aromatics like onions, garlic, thyme, and smoked meats, absorbing flavors while maintaining their own distinctive, slightly earthy character. The overall taste experience is comforting, full-bodied, and rich in umami, making them a versatile choice for both simple and complex dishes.

From Our Mill to Your Table
A mill built on passion, heritage, and Southern grit.
What started as a childhood fascination became Marsh Hen Mill — a small but mighty operation led by Greg Johnsman, who learned the craft from a third-generation miller and turned an old 1945 mill into a thriving business. Nestled on a sea island in South Carolina, we honor time-tested techniques to bring rich, authentic flavor to your table—one stone-ground batch at a time.
